Felicitousness
Felicitousness noun - The quality or state of being especially suitable or fitting.
Usage example: guests remarked on the perfect felicitousness of the rose garden as a site for a June wedding
Inaptness is an antonym for felicitousness.
Inaptness
Inaptness noun - The quality or state of being unsuitable or unfitting.
Usage example: the inaptness of the ski outfit made her stand out among the somberly dressed mourners
Felicitousness is an antonym for inaptness.
